I like the shadings on the clothes, it looks clean. However the pants kinda give me the metallic impression.

yeah i can see that,
I actually took a long time trying to make the pants look better with different colors, shading patterns, but in the end, this is what looked best ingame, since the wrap uses the same leg for the front and the back, and blends on the sides.
 
It looks pretty cool in the texture, but once wrapped it's hard to tell it's even a pirate at all. The shadow hunter model simply has too distinct of a shape, making it so that any reskin will still look like pretty much the same thing; it's not your fault, but the usefulness of this is pretty limited. Quality-wise, it's a little above average. Also, making a troll out of a troll isn't very creative. What's really nice to see is when somebody manages to make something attractive out of a texture that was originally something entirely different.

3/5.
